Stars look to improve playoff standing against Coyotes
Apr 3, 2008 - 4:25 PM Dallas (43-29-7) at Phoenix (37-36-6) 10:00 pm EDTGLENDALE, Arizona (Ticker) - The Dallas Stars already have clinched a postseason berth.
The club tries to improve its standing in the Western Conference on Thursday when it visits the Phoenix Coyotes.
Dallas (43-29-7) is currently tied with the Colorado Avalanche (43-31-7) for fifth place in the Western Conference at 93 points.
However, the Stars have three games remaining while the Avalanche conclude their regular season against the Minnesota Wild on Sunday.
The Stars won't crack the top three seeds in the West, which are awarded to division winners, but still have an outside shot at sneaking past the Anaheim Ducks (45-27-8), who currently occupy fourth place with 98 points.
The Ducks prevented Dallas from picking up a full two points on Sunday. Mike Modano and Niklas Hagman each scored for the Stars, but it wasn't enough as they suffered a 3-2 shootout setback to the defending Stanley Cup champions.
Phoenix endured a 3-1 loss to the San Jose Sharks on Sunday, falling to 1-6-1 during its last eight games.
The Coyotes, who have been eliminated from playoff contention as a result of their recent slide, haven't qualified for the postseason since the 2001-02 season.
